Leading politicians on both sides of the aisle have quickly responded to what law enforcement officials told The Associated Press was an apparent assassination attempt on former President Donald Trump at his July 13 rally in Pennsylvania. One attendee was killed and two seriously injured, according to county authorities. 
“There’s no place in America for this kind of violence. It’s sick, it’s sick,” President Biden said at the emergency briefing room in Rehoboth, Delaware.
“It’s one of the reasons we have to unite this country,” he said. “We cannot allow for this to be happening. We cannot be like this. We cannot condone this.”…
